Definition and details for revolution/second (rps):
Revolutions per second (rps) is a unit of frequency, defined as a full rotation around a fixed axis completed in one second. Rps is used as a measure of rotational speed of a mechanical component. One rps is equal to 60 rpm.
Definition and details for exahertz:
Exahertz (EHz) is a unit of frequency equal to 1018 Hz. For example radiation with frequency greater than 300 EHz are gamma rays.
